Co-development of Qingdaogang port-Shandong Economic Region system is studied inthis thesis. In the background of the development of the global economical unify and theeconomy center concentrating along the coast, the port-hinterland system has become theimportant role in the development of the regional economy. Port not only stimulates the localcity and hinterland economy. In turn, the developed economic strength of hinterland canprovide the services and development environment, and enhance the competitiveness of theport. With the economic center of China moving to the north, the economic regional system isfacing the enormous opportunities and challenges, which is composed of Shandong Provinceand Qingdaogang Port. With the framework of Shandong peninsula blue economic zone, thisdissertation argues the spatial interaction of this system and finds the existing problem in thedevelopment of port and hinterland, and analyzes the cause of problems, to provide referencefor studying the development of other ports and hinterlands.Based on the theoretical research results about the relationships of the port-hinterland athome and abroad, building a comprehensive evaluation index system of associative degree,this dissertation analyzes the mean value correlation degree of Qingdaogang Port-ShandongEconomic Region by grey correlation analysis method during the period2001~2010as wellas the driving factors affecting the correlation degree of the system with the practical situationof Qingdaogang Port and Shandong Economic Region. Some conclusions are drawn asfollows:(1) The correlation degree of Qingdaogang Port and Qingdao city diminished, therelationship has entered a low period.(2) The correlation degree of Qingdaogangport-Shandong Economic Region manifests a phase-by phase evolution. The higher degree ofassociation is in the north and south, and then it transfers to the east, and at the third stage itgoes to the midland.(3) The changes of correlation degree are affected by various factors.(4)These driving factors affecting the interactive level of Qingdaogang Port-Shandong EconomicRegion are natural conditions and locations, infrastructure and transportation, economic leveland the integration degree of hinterland, policy environment, and competition with otherports.This dissertation is composed of six parts.Pare One: Introduction, presents the background and the meaning of research, as well asthe relationship of port-hinterland system at home and abroad; the problem to solve andresearch method are brought forward.
